首页 > 简文 > 精选范文 >

excel怎么把一个工作表导出来

2025-10-01 18:08:23

问题描述:

excel怎么把一个工作表导出来,急!求解答,求别让我失望!

最佳答案

推荐答案

2025-10-01 18:08:23

excel怎么把一个工作表导出来】在日常使用Excel的过程中,用户常常需要将某个工作表单独导出,以便与其他文件进行分享、备份或进一步处理。本文将详细说明如何将Excel中的一个工作表导出为独立的文件,并提供不同方法的步骤说明。

一、直接复制粘贴法(适用于少量数据)

这种方法适合数据量不大、只需要快速导出的情况。

步骤 操作说明
1 打开原始Excel文件,选中需要导出的工作表标签。
2 右键点击该工作表标签,选择“移动或复制”。
3 在弹出的窗口中,勾选“建立副本”,然后选择目标位置(可以是同一文件或新文件)。
4 点击确定后,系统会生成一个新的工作表副本。
5 将新工作表保存为独立的Excel文件即可。

> 注意:此方法只是复制了工作表内容,并未真正“导出”为独立文件,但可作为临时解决方案。

二、另存为独立文件法(推荐方式)

这是最常用、最可靠的方法,适用于所有版本的Excel。

步骤 操作说明
1 打开原始Excel文件,右键点击需要导出的工作表标签。
2 选择“移动或复制”。
3 勾选“建立副本”,并选择“新工作簿”作为目标位置。
4 点击确定,系统会自动创建一个包含该工作表的新Excel文件。
5 保存新文件到指定路径,完成导出。

> 优点:操作简单,保留原格式和公式,适合正式使用。

三、使用VBA宏导出(高级用户适用)

对于熟悉VBA编程的用户,可以通过编写宏来批量导出多个工作表。

步骤 操作说明
1 按 `Alt + F11` 打开VBA编辑器。
2 插入 → 模块,粘贴以下代码:

```vba

Sub ExportSheet()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1") ' 修改为你的工作表名称

ws.Copy

ActiveWorkbook.SaveAs Filename:="C:\ExportedSheet.xlsx" ' 修改保存路径

End Sub

```

> 注意:需确保路径正确,避免覆盖已有文件。

四、使用Power Query导出(适用于复杂数据)

如果你的数据来自外部数据源,可以通过Power Query整理后导出:

3 运行宏,系统会将指定工作表保存为独立文件。
步骤 操作说明
1 在Excel中选择“数据”选项卡,点击“获取数据”→“从工作簿”。
2 导入所需工作表,通过Power Query进行清洗或筛选。
3 完成后点击“关闭并上载”,数据将被导入新的工作表。
4 再次使用“移动或复制”功能,将其保存为独立文件。

总结

方法 适用场景 优点 缺点
复制粘贴 数据量小 快速简单 不便于后续管理
另存为独立文件 一般用途 安全稳定 需手动操作
VBA宏 高级用户 自动化处理 需要编程基础
Power Query 数据清洗 数据结构清晰 学习成本高

通过以上几种方法,你可以根据实际需求灵活选择最适合自己的导出方式。无论是日常办公还是数据分析,掌握这些技巧都能大大提高工作效率。

以上就是【excel怎么把一个工作表导出来】相关内容,希望对您有所帮助。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。